Cadence
Days spool into each other,
clouds stew cross the sky
and cold inhibits
the birth of spring.
I'm lustful for the sun.
When her smile flames
colors rush along the horizon
and glide through the fields
in search of slivers of green.
Cheeks blow warm air
in fragile cadence
and brush across
my face feather soft
to sweep away winter.
My soul stretches
and sparks to life
as spring sails in
on warm currents
and I feel my spirit dance.
